Navigating the Law: Magic Mushrooms in Australia

The current standing of copyright hallucinogenic mushrooms in Australia is complicated and constantly changing. Currently, they remain prohibited under state and regional legislation, designated as Schedule 9 drugs. Having and distribution lead to serious penalties, including monetary penalties and possible prison terms. However, a recent medical permit enables registered medical professionals to provide the substance for severe mental health conditions within a supervised environment. This major change highlights the continuing conversation surrounding the policy of psychoactive substances and these potential advantages.

The Most Common Magic Mushroom Types Found in Australia

Identifying copyright fungi in Australia can be tricky, but a few varieties are relatively frequently encountered. The Psilocybe cubensis is arguably the most recognized, found across various regions, especially in animal enriched habitats. Similarly, Psilocybe subcubica, a related relative, is a common find. While infrequently than the others, Psilocybe australis also occurs, generally in bush settings. It's vital to remember that possessing or producing these fungi is illegal, and proper identification requires specialist knowledge.
